Capturing excellent lighting in photography is an artwork type that requires a blend of technical skill and instinct. Understanding the assorted features of sunshine can significantly enhance the standard of your pictures. Light can both make or break an image, and understanding how to use it successfully can transform strange subjects into gorgeous visuals.


Natural light is often considered the greatest choice for photography, as it offers a gentle, even illumination that can be flattering to most topics. The golden hour, which happens shortly after sunrise and earlier than sundown, presents a heat diffused light that can elevate your outside photographs. This time of day creates long shadows and a singular ambiance that attracts the viewer's eye, making it a favourite amongst photographers.


Understanding the place of the solar all through the day may help you plan your shoots strategically - Photography Workshops Orlando. Midday sun can be harsh and unflattering, creating deep shadows that can distort your topic. In this case, utilizing shade or finding a more favorable location can help you capture higher lighting with out the extremes of brightness.


When shooting indoors, window mild is a incredible possibility to contemplate. Natural light filtering via home windows adds a soft, pleasing quality to photographs. Positioning your subject close to the window can create stunning highlights and shadows, amplifying texture and depth in your images. Curtains or sheer material can diffuse the light even further, preventing harsh contrasts.

Artificial lighting also can play a major role in photography. Understanding the various forms of gentle sources—such as LED lights, strobes, and continuous lights—allows for versatile capturing options. Using softboxes or reflectors may help soften harsh shadows and management the course of the light. This makes it easier to attain the desired mood and aesthetic.


Experimenting with light modifiers can result in thrilling outcomes. Umbrellas and softboxes can unfold and diffuse mild, making a soft, flattering glow round your topics. Conversely, using grid spots or snoots can create dramatic shadows and defined highlights, which may enhance specific elements inside your body. Every modification allows for artistic exploration and may drastically change the final photograph.


Another facet to contemplate is the white steadiness in your digital camera settings. Different light sources have distinctive color temperatures that can affect the overall look of your images. Using the right settings ensures that colors seem extra natural. Auto white stability works in many instances, however manual changes can provide greater management, particularly in mixed lighting conditions.

Understanding the concept of exposure is essential when capturing good lighting. A well-exposed photograph balances the light throughout the scene, capturing details in each highlights and shadows. The three main elements to achieve this steadiness are aperture, shutter pace, and ISO. Adjusting these settings can permit for exquisite renditions of sunshine, whether you desire a shallow depth of subject or to freeze motion in bright circumstances.


Utilizing the histogram on your camera can be a useful tool. It supplies a visible representation of the tonal range in your picture, helping you make changes in actual time. By preserving your histogram inside the boundaries, you presumably can keep away from clipped highlights and deep shadows that can detract from the magnificence of your composition.


Post-processing is an excellent way to refine the lighting in your photographs further. Software like Adobe Lightroom or Photoshop presents various tools to enhance publicity, contrast, and color steadiness. You can make refined adjustments that may dramatically enhance how gentle interacts together with your photograph, bringing out particulars that may have been misplaced straight out of the camera.

Incorporating outdoor parts can also enhance the lighting of your photographs. Reflective surfaces, like water or sand, can bounce gentle onto your subject, creating a unique and captivating glow. Similarly, city environments filled with glass and metal can provide fascinating reflections and high-contrast gentle patterns, including depth and complexity to your photographs.


For photographers who wish to push artistic boundaries, shooting in low-light situations can yield fascinating outcomes. This situation requires an excellent understanding of your digicam's capabilities in addition to a gentle hand or a tripod. Low mild can create moody, atmospheric pictures that seize emotion and intrigue. Experimenting with longer exposures can result in gorgeous visuals that showcase movement and lightweight in unique methods.


Always keep in thoughts that practice makes good. Regularly experimenting with totally different lighting conditions and settings will refine your capability to seize the best gentle potential. Keeping a journal or log regarding what works and what doesn’t may help in understanding how totally different mild influences your fashion and outcomes.
